Joe Lonnett
[edit] Biography
Joe Lonnett (Joseph Paul Lonnett) was born on February 7, 1927 in Beaver Falls, Pennsylvania. He made his Major League debut on April 22, 1956 for the Philadelphia Phillies. In 1957, his rookie year, he hit .169 with 5 home runs and 15 RBI. Lonnett played for the Philadelphia Phillies for his entire 4 year career.

[edit] Transactions
- Signed as an amateur free agent by Philadelphia Phillies (April 14, 1948).
- Traded by Philadelphia Phillies to Milwaukee Braves in exchange for Carl Sawatski (June 13, 1958).
- Traded by Milwaukee Braves with Earl Hersh to Detroit Tigers in exchange for Charlie Lau and Al Paschal (May 28, 1959); Joe Lonnett refused to report to Detroit Tigers; Earl Hersh returned to Milwaukee Braves and Charlie Lau returned to Detroit Tigers and Al Paschal returned to Detroit Tigers (May 28, 1959).
- Sold by Milwaukee Braves to Philadelphia Phillies (June 18, 1959).
